Abstract

This research aims to examine the role of Nizamiyah in the development of Islamic education in the early period. Nizamiyah, as an Islamic educational institution founded in the 11th century by Nizam al-Mulk, has an important role in disseminating knowledge and educating Muslim scholars and scholars. This research uses the research library method by analyzing various relevant literature and historical sources, including manuscripts, books, journal articles and other scientific works. Through this qualitative approach, the research seeks to provide a comprehensive picture of Nizamiyah's contribution to intellectual and educational development in the history of Islamic civilization. The research results show that Nizamiyah not only functions as an educational center, but also as a center for the dissemination of ideologies and thoughts that have a wide influence in the Islamic world.

Abstract

This study aims to examine organizational structure from various perspectives, with a specific focus on Islamic education, through a literature review approach. The definition of organizational structure encompasses the division of work, determination of authority, and relationships among individuals within the organization, as discussed by various experts. Key elements addressed include work specialization, departmentalization, chain of command, span of control, centralization and decentralization, and formalization. The study also identifies differences in organizational structures, particularly between mechanistic models, which are formal and bureaucratic, and organic models, which are more flexible and participative. Types of organizational structures reviewed include line, line and staff, functional, line and functional, matrix, and committee organizations. Additionally, this research highlights the importance of developing organizational structures in response to changes in business strategies, company growth, and external regulations. The findings indicate that adapting organizational structures to environmental changes and operational needs is crucial for enhancing organizational effectiveness and efficiency. Using the literature review method, this study concludes that an adaptive and integrative approach to managing organizational structures, especially in the context of Islamic education, can positively contribute to achieving organizational goals and improving management quality.

Abstract

The purpose of this writing is to discuss Nidhal Guessoum's study of his thoughts, namely the correlation between Islam and modern science. The explanation is about cosmology, from classical (medieval) Islamic philosophy, scientific interpretation, traditionalism, and modern science from various points of view of Muslim thinkers. This article, which uses a literature study using a qualitative approach, discusses Nidhal Guessoum's thoughts on Islam and modern science. The idea of Islamic/theistic cosmology put forward by Nidhal is the result of his opinion. Cosmology is used as a circle in the frame of monotheism. His opinion on scientific issues such as cosmology cannot be answered by science, but requires a Muslim with his identity to study science while still believing in the existence of God. According to Nidhal, the emphasis of Islamic cosmology should not only be in the form of scientific interpretation or scientific interpretation as has been embodied by some munfasir. Nidhal's alternative as an offer to ideas that apparently contain weaknesses and cannot be developed is the quantum approach. The quantum approach is based on three principles to be an integration of religion with modern science

Abstract

This study aims to examine the implementation of Islamic-based character education to build morality and ethics in educational institutions by integrating Islamic values into curricula, teaching methods, and extracurricular activities. Using the library research method, data were collected from journals, books, policy documents, and scholarly articles. In-depth analysis identified key concepts, principles, and best practices in Islamic-based character education. The findings reveal that a holistic approach involving teachers, students, parents, and communities is essential for success. Islamic-based character education effectively fosters individuals with strong morality, character resilience, and ethical commitment. The study provides practical recommendations for educators and policymakers to design relevant and effective character education programs that address modern moral challenges.
